Frequently Asked Questions

  • Where is Lake Yamanaka located?

    Lake Yamanaka is situated in Yamanashi Prefecture, near the base of Mount Fuji. It is part of the Fuji Five Lakes area, surrounded by forested hills and local villages.

  • When is the best time to visit Lake Yamanaka?

    Late spring and early autumn are often recommended for Lake Yamanaka, when the temperatures range from 50–74°F (10–24°C) and natural scenery is especially vibrant. Summer brings warmer weather and outdoor activities are frequently suggested.

  • What are some things to do near Lake Yamanaka?

    You can explore cycling paths, lakeside parks, and bird-watching areas around Lake Yamanaka. The region has hot spring baths, local craft shops, and views of Mount Fuji that are frequently suggested for visitors.

  • How is the weather near Lake Yamanaka?

    Lake Yamanaka has cool winters from 34–50°F (1–10°C) and warm summers reaching 74–88°F (24–31°C). Rain is more common in late spring and early autumn, so a light jacket and umbrella can be helpful year-round.
